Anton Ishutin produces deep house, nu disco, and indie dance tracks across labels including Pepper Cat, Deep Strips, and Suprematic since 2013. His sound spans from organic downtempo to driving house, with 38 releases demonstrating consistent output in the underground scene.

DJ Pierre
Nathaniel Pierre Jones, known as DJ Pierre, is a Chicago house producer from Harvey who pioneered acid house with Phuture in the mid-1980s. His releases span house, tech house and deep house across labels including Strictly Rhythm, Get Physical Music and his own Afro Acid Digital imprint.

How We Found These Deep House Artist Connections
These recommendations are computed from Electrobuzz's archive of 172,163+ releases. Each artist's connection score is based on three signals: shared label affiliations (artists releasing on the same imprints), overlapping genre coverage (artists working in the same musical territories), and direct collaborations (co-releases, remixes, and compilation appearances). The rankings update automatically as new music is published.
